It seems to have been released yesterday, together with a new version of console and relationship explorer

Did receive an error on the Summary on the ISVIntegration part though:


An error occurred in enabling the ISV integationSystem.Exception: System.Exception: An error occurred in exporting the CRM settings CODE: 0x80044150 DESCRIPTION: Generic SQL error. TYPE: Platform MESSAGE: Server was unable to process request. at c360.ProductDeployment.ConfigurationActions.Actions.Common.Crm.CrmInterface.PrivateExportCRMSettings() at c360.ProductDeployment.ConfigurationActions.Actions.EnableISVIntegration.EnableISVIntegration.GetOrganizationSettings(CrmConfigurationData crmConfigurationData) at c360.ProductDeployment.ConfigurationActions.Actions.EnableISVIntegration.EnableISVIntegration.GetOrganizationSettings(CrmConfigurationData crmConfigurationData) at c360.ProductDeployment.ConfigurationActions.Actions.EnableISVIntegration.EnableISVIntegration.EnableISV(IConfigurationData configurationData)

Runnig the CRM Integration from the Summary Configuration (c360 Settings) manually completed succesfully.
